How do you determine the Scoville level of hot sauce?
In the original formulation, a solution of pepper extract is diluted in sugar water until the “hot” is no longer noticeable by a panel of (typically five) tasters; the degree of dilution determines the scale’s value on the Scoville scale.

You might be interested: How To Bake Thick Cut Pork Chops And Sauerkraut? (Solution found)What’s the hottest pepper on the Scoville scale?
1. Carolina Reaper – 2,200,000 SHU (Standard Human Units). According to some, the Carolina Reaper pepper, which was widely considered to be the hottest pepper available in 2013, ranks first on this scale with a whopping 2,200,000 Scoville Heat Units. The powerful flavor of this pepper, which was developed in South Carolina, has won it a great deal of attention over the last several years.
